Transaction 34cbe08b125844945b1571b38582de1891e529ff80d35138a5b1a715c9c13fac
2 Input
2 Outputs
- 34cbe08b125844945b1571b38582de1891e529ff80d35138a5b1a715c9c13fac:0
- 34cbe08b125844945b1571b38582de1891e529ff80d35138a5b1a715c9c13fac:1
value 78911769
address 1Hg319EmKWB4bFua83oDXRZ4svWXoV8FSM
value 2145947
address 1HFUGEANw8p6fvbqUhDXQQUjDuGFov2kAr